Skip to main content

How to Issue Rewards Based on Multiple Actions

Updated over 2 weeks ago

With our custom event triggering feature, you can now issue different rewards for different referral-related actions, making your referral program more dynamic, flexible, and tailored to your funnel.

What Are Custom Events?

Custom events are actions that you define (e.g., "demo booked", "became customer") that can be used to trigger rewards at specific points in the customer journey, not just after a single signup or conversion.

Example Use Case: Tiered Rewards for Referrals

You can now create multiple rewards for the same referral, based on what their friend does: For example:

Action Taken by the Person Invited

Reward Given to the Person Referring

Friend books a demo

Referrer gets $10

Friend becomes a paying customer

Referrer gets an additional $50

How to set it up

Step 1: Create A Custom event

  1. In your campaign dashboard, go to the “Actions” column.

  2. From the dropdown - select Events.

  3. Add your new event.

  4. Give it a descriptive name you will remember later.

  5. Click "Create".

Your event will become available for reward logic and webhooks.

Step 2: Fire the new event to trigger the reward


1. Go to the Users tab, locate the user who completed the event.
2. Click on the Actions column and scroll down to Events.
3. You'll see a list of your events.
4. Click on the Fire button to fire the events and trigger the reward.

Step 3: Create the reward for your event

  1. Go to the Rewards tab.

  2. Create a new reward.

  3. Select the custom event that the reward should be triggered on.

  4. Activate the reward.

If you have any questions, feel free to reach out to our friendly support team for further assistance. You can email them at [email protected]

Did this answer your question?